About the role Cyber security is one of the most critical strategic risks facing organisations today, consistently ranked as a top concern by CEOs. Rapid digital transformation, disrupted supply chains and evolving workforces are increasing both the scale and complexity of cyber risk. PwC helps clients transform with confidence by enabling secure change and long-term cyber resilience. Our UK Cyber Security practice brings together strategy, risk and governance with deep technical delivery and assurance, supported by a team of over 250 specialists. Driven by strong client demand, cyber security remains a key strategic growth area for PwC. PwC UK provides market‑leading Identity and Access Management (IAM) services, supporting clients across the full IAM lifecycle from strategy and operating model design to technology implementation and optimisation. We help organisations securely enable digital and cloud transformation, govern access, manage identity through change, and evolve towards more automated, risk‑based identity models. As a Director in IAM, you will lead large-scale programmes across workforce, customer and non‑human identities, shaping and delivering IAM strategies and deploying technologies such as CyberArk, Microsoft Entra and Active Directory, Okta and Saviynt. What your days will look like: Leading the development and delivery of IAM strategies, operating models and transformation roadmaps across multiple sectors Providing senior leadership across complex IAM programmes, often comprising multiple workstreams and technologies Advising clients on IAM best practices, standards and regulatory requirements (e.g. GDPR, ISO 27001, NIST) Embedding Zero Trust principles and risk-based access models into client IAM architectures Driving business growth through the expansion of IAM offerings and trusted client relationships Leading, mentoring and developing high-performing IAM and cyber security teams Evaluating emerging IAM technologies and approaches, ensuring PwC remains at the forefront of the identity market Maintaining a strong understanding of evolving IAM standards, protocols and regulatory developments The role is for you if: Extensive experience designing, delivering and operating IAM solutions in large, complex and regulated environments, with a strong focus on Zero Trust and alignment to broader cyber, cloud and enterprise architecture strategies Deep hands‑on and architectural expertise across leading IAM platforms including CyberArk, Microsoft identity technologies (Active Directory, Entra ID), Okta, Ping, SailPoint and Saviynt, operating at scale in cloud‑first and hybrid environments Strong understanding of core identity capabilities such as access management, federation, identity governance, privileged access, non‑human identities, and certificate, key and cryptographic services, including PKI and certificate lifecycle management Expert knowledge of authentication and authorisation standards and protocols including OAuth 2.0, OpenID Connect, SAML and Kerberos, with awareness of emerging concepts such as crypto‑agility and quantum‑resilient identity approaches Experience advising on and implementing modern identity capabilities including ITDR, ISPM and shared IAM services frameworks, delivering solutions in line with recognised standards such as NIST, ISO 27001 and CSA Proven ability to communicate complex technical concepts clearly to senior executives and technical stakeholders, translating IAM outcomes into tangible business value Significant experience in cyber security roles with a strong specialism in Identity and Access Management, supported by a degree in computer science, information systems or equivalent professional experience, and relevant certifications such as CISSP, CISM, CIAM or SABSA or have equivalent work experience.
